What is the Temporary Work Visa?
The Colombian Temporary Worker Visa (Type V) is designed for foreign professionals hired by a company legally established in Colombia. unlike open work permits, this visa is tied exclusively to the sponsoring employer, authorizing you to work only for the entity that signs your contract.
Our team verifies that your employer meets the substantial financial solvency requirements (100 monthly minimum wages) and guides both parties through the contract formalization to ensure Ministry compliance. Valid for up to two years (or the duration of the contract), this visa allows you to include beneficiaries (spouse and children), offering a secure legal status for your family while you advance your career in Colombia.
Requirements: Temporary Worker Visa
-
Passport & Identity Coherence
Ministry Criterion Must be valid for at least 6 months. All professional background checks and diplomas must match your passport identity exactly. Compliance Risks Name discrepancies between foreign labor certificates and your current ID lead to immediate "Inadmissible" statuses.★ USP ADVANTAGEOur lawyers cross-verify your identity across all professional documentation before submission. Hiring Entity Solvency
Ministry Criterion The Colombian company must prove financial capacity via bank statements showing an average balance of 100+ minimum wages. Technical Risks Providing incomplete or non-certified bank statements for the hiring company is a top cause for visa denial.★ USP ADVANTAGEWe perform a financial pre-screening of your employer to ensure they meet the Ministry's solvency standards. Temporary Work Visa (Type V)
The efficient legal solution for short-term professional projects and technical assistance. We ensure your temporary assignment in Colombia is fully protected and compliant with migration standards.
Up to 2-Year Validity
The Visitor Visa (Type V) for work is granted for up to 2 years, precisely aligned with the duration of your professional contract or assignment.
Project Specific
Tailored for technical assistance, specialized training, or professional services provided to a specific Colombian entity or project.
Limited work permit
A work permit is issued for the specific company and position listed on the visa application. If you change your position or employer, you will need to complete additional procedures, such as a visa transfer.
Company Backing
We guide the inviting company in providing the required financial and legal documentation, ensuring they meet the Ministry's solvency thresholds.
Cédula Access
Visas granted for more than 3 months allow you to obtain a Foreigner ID card (Cédula), simplifying local banking and operational logistics.
